Anhydrous Calcium Chloride, a colorless and hygroscopic solid, is derived from limestone or can be produced as a byproduct of soda ash manufacturing. Its chemical formula, CaCl2, signifies that it consists of calcium and chloride ions, which attribute to its excellent capacity for absorbing moisture from the air. This unique property makes Anhydrous Calcium Chloride a preferred choice for desiccation purposes, particularly in environments where maintaining low humidity is critical.
In the construction industry, Anhydrous Calcium Chloride serves a vital role in accelerating concrete curing times. When added to concrete mixes, it increases the heat of hydration, speeding up the setting process. This not only allows for quicker project completion but also ensures that construction timelines are adhered to, ultimately saving costs and improving productivity. Another prominent use of Anhydrous Calcium Chloride is in road maintenance, particularly in winter. As a de-icing agent, it effectively melts ice and snow by lowering the freezing point of water. The compound's efficacy allows for safer driving conditions and reduces the hazards associated with winter weather. Its ability to draw moisture helps in preventing the formation of ice, making it a key consideration for municipalities and businesses looking to maintain public safety during colder months.
Food preservation is yet another area where Anhydrous Calcium Chloride shines. It is often used in brines to pickle foods, where it can help maintain crispness by regulating moisture levels. In the cheese-making process, it is added to milk to improve its curdling properties, enhancing the quality and taste of the final product. The FDA recognizes Anhydrous Calcium Chloride as a safe additive, making it a trusted choice for various food applications.
